  • Mulligatawny Soup Recipe - How To Make Mulligatawny Soup - Chicken Soup Recipe
    Traditionally Indians did not drink soup though there have been many soupy dishes. This soup's origins were from rasam which is a spice infused pepper water using the thin liquid lifted from the very top of a pot of cooked split peas. Rasams are always sour and hot and is either drunk as a digestive at the start of a meal or eaten with rice. The sourness comes from the addition of tamarind water but I used lemon juice in this recipe as it is so conveniently available everywhere.The name Mulligatawny originated from the Tamil words "milagu"(black peppercorns) and "tanni" (water), that is pepper water. The recipe was modified by The British by adding chicken/mutton to it and was thickened by flour and butter. It is served over rice and is a meal by itself.
    Ingredients For Making Mulligatawny Soup - Serves 8
    For the spice paste -
    1 tablespoon cumin seeds
    1 tablespoon coriander seeds
    2 heaped teaspoon black peppercorns (please use 1 teaspoon if you want it to be less spicy)

    1/4 th teaspoon red chilli powder (optional)
    1/4 th teaspoon turmeric powder
    6 cloves
    1 handful fresh coriander leaves with stalks
    6 to 7 mint leaves or 1 teaspoon dried mint leaves
    can even use 7 to 8 fresh curry leaves (optional)
    2 teaspoons finely grated ginger
    2 teaspoons finely grated garlic
    1/4 th cup water to make a paste (add little more if you see the blades of your blender not working)
    For The Soup -
    12 oz/ 340 gm boneless, skinless chicken thighs. Can even use boneless lamb/mutton
    150 gm (1 large) onion chopped
    1 dried bay leaf
    2 inch length cinnamon stick
    100 gm/ 2 carrots
    4 tablespoons slivered almonds or cashews
    700 ml chicken stock (broth). You can even use just water or a chicken bouillon in water.
    200 ml thick coconut milk. You can add more if you like coconut.
    2 teaspoons salt or as per taste
    2 tablespoons lemon/lime juice (add less if you like it to be less sour)
    Serve it with plain white rice.
